Federation parliament speaker and deputy voted out – BalkanInsight

FBiH parliamentarians voted yesterday to remove Speaker of the House of Representatives Denis Zvizdić and Deputy Speaker Stanko Primorac. The speaker and his deputy belong to the SDA and HSP
